A couple of weeks ago, TEDxTysons asked if I could make some photos of the State Theater for them. Similarly to the very first shoot, I ever did for them, Ashwood and I met at the venue for their upcoming main event. In contrast to the soaring heights of a tall commercial building, we were at the State Theater in Falls Church.

While we were on site, we had the stage managers set the lighting. As can be seen here, the saturated red and purple colors flooded the stage as they will during their event. With this in mind, these images would be used as teasers for ‘Legacy’ scheduled for this coming November.

State Theater – Exterior

Outside, the theater set the lettering on the marquee saying that the show was sold out. Afterwards, I had retouchers change this to have the date of the show. Thus same images can be used for 2 different uses! This was a fun project to work on. I hope it works to pack the house in November – join us!
